     Mayor Burzichelli opened the floor to the public.

 

     Theresa Cooper questioned if the Flood maps have been rezoned.

 

     Mayor Burzichelli stated the Army Corps of Engineers has performed re-evaluations on the Flood zones and there is a new map that takes effect soon.  Ms. Cooper may not be in a flood zone anymore as there were changes to the map.  He suggested Ms. Cooper stop in at Borough Hall and look at the map.

 

     There wasn’t any further public participation.

     Councilman Giovannitti discussed the position of Operator and Maintenance Work Leader.  He stated Bill Virden has been working in this position without the title.  He would like to give Bill Virden the title of Operator and Maintenance Work Leader with no upgrade in pay as it is the same amount of pay in the salary ordinance as he is making now as Highway Maintenance 1st Grade.

 

     R. #44.10:  RESOLUTION UPGRADING WILLIAM VIRDEN IN HIS POSITION AS OPERATOR AND MAINTENANCE WORK LEADER FOR THE BOROUGH OF PAULSBORO.  Hamilton moved and Giovannitti seconded to adopt R. #44.10.

 

     Councilman Kidd questioned if Council could promote someone without a pay raise.

 

     Solicitor DeTitto stated the contract should be looked at to see if there was anything in the contract regarding this.

 

     Haynes moved and Giovannitti seconded to hold adopting the Resolution until Solicitor DeTitto has had a chance to review the contract.  All were in favor of the motion.

 

     Chief Grogan stated the Police Department is in the middle of hiring for the grant.  They have interviewed 39 candidates so far.

 

     Chief Grogan discussed his budget and that he is 10% under his operating budget but the overtime budget continues to rise.  His goal is to not exceed the previous year’s overtime budget.
